#446b25 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#446b25 is composed of 26.7% red, 42%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.4%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 93.4 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 28.2%. #446b25 color hex could be obtained by blending #88d64a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#446b25
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030502 is the darkest color, while #f8fc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#446b25
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484a46 is the less saturated color, while #408c04 is the most saturated one.
